Use the unit circle to find the value of tan 315°.

1 Answer

3 votes

The unit circle (radius is one unit) for the trigonometric function is,

The coordinate of point P is,


P(\frac{\sqrt[]{2}}{2},-\frac{\sqrt[]{2}}{2})

So value of tan 315 is,


\begin{gathered} \tan 315=\frac{-\frac{\sqrt[]{2}}{2}}{\frac{\sqrt[]{2}}{2}} \\ =-1 \end{gathered}

Answer: -1
